Eris wrote:House Rule on Stewards: I was a bit surprised about the 1 level per 2 passengers thing, so I went looking and found that has varied from edition to edition.

I'm going to say that it's 4 passengers per level starting at Steward-0. JOAT counts as Steward-0. Anyone can be hired/assigned Steward duties. Those without any Steward skill at all can attempt to "fake it", using their SOC/3 as a DM as a modifier on an 8+ or 10+ roll.
OK, so Carlos as-is can handle 4 of them, and our crack pilot with Steward-1 can get the rest. :D

I'm thinking Carlos will try to train up to Steward-1 over the flight.
Yes, you two can cover it.

I need to set up a Training Thread where we can track who is training in what and how. Remember, you have to train for a number of weeks equal to your current number of skill levels you have plus one, but using one of the 10,000 cr training programs means each week counts as 2.

ffilz wrote:Hmm, in the character sheets, you dropped my dagger-1 and made electronics-1 instead of electronics-0.

I'll want one of those skinsuits, how much? I guess I never purchased any gear... I should get a dagger and a shotgun (I think I was training in shotgun). Dunno what else I should gear up with? Combo mask? IR/LI combo goggles? Mechanical tools? Communicators?
I'll fix the skills.

A skinsuit costs 15,000 cr, requires a fitting and takes a week to make. Gloves, tank, regulator, and a bubble helmet are thrown in for free. Protects like Cloth Armor in all atmospheres, but only temporarily effective in Insidious (C)...2d6 hours.

I also found “Boarding Axe” in Central Supply Catalogue!

Axe, Boarding (TL 9): A modern version of the halberd with a short haft, the boarding axe is a combination of axe and spear for close assault work. Most have an optional spade head, which can be swapped for the axe in a few seconds. Damage 3d6+2 120Cr 2kg

The "Boarding Pistol" Sigrun was joking about is, of course, a sawn off side by side shotgun with a pistol grip. Should anyone want one!

And just a thought on the Zero G skill mentioned in the armour section. I believe this is the CES catch all for the “old skool” skills Vacc Suit and Zero G Cbt. So a few of us are really quite proficient at “Zero G” skill - presuming that the old skills add together.

Sigrun is Zero G 2 (Vacc Suit 1, Zero G Cbt 1), as is Carlos (Vacc Suit 2) while Pedro is king with Zero G 3 (Vacc-1, ZeroG-2).

I moved Combat & Surprise to it's own post, hopefully to clarify things a bit.

1. No AHL or Snapshot AP's. There's noting wrong with AP systems for tactical combat, but I'm going for something a lot more simple...and loose. We're using a simplified "range" system. Every weapon has an "optimal" range and there are +/-DM's for attacking beyond or at very close ranges.

2. A full round of aiming will get you a +1 DM, longer probably won't get more, but depending upon your description of things you might get a +2. Firing while moving, or drawing/unslinging and firing in the same round will get you a negative DM...depending upon how you describe it I'll decide just how big a -DM...probably -0 to -3.

3. I'm trying not to codify every possible case. I'll assign DM's situationally, and on how players describe what they are trying to do.
